Transaction e3b2d31cff3963ebac178f7a430b691b1fbe3c3bc2813ec304848c7e276857a2

25 Input
2 Outputs
  • e3b2d31cff3963ebac178f7a430b691b1fbe3c3bc2813ec304848c7e276857a2:0
  • value  110548316
    address  3M9h1sf2DTptLQ3YRWKTeXbKwiSECfVF7N
  • e3b2d31cff3963ebac178f7a430b691b1fbe3c3bc2813ec304848c7e276857a2:1
  • value  10160234
    address  37k9rJpFxqpiqkxBKU22ogvsyatgxEi59o